Determine about the prokaryotic cell
While we describe in detail the structure of a eukaryotic cell, it will be useful to examine the structural features of a typical prokaryotic cell as well. Escllericllia coli is an organism found in the intestinal tract of all human beings, and represents a typical prokaryotic organism, which has been intensively investigated. An E.coli cell is about 2pm long and 1 pm in diameter (Fig.l.2). Its cell wall is made of a rigid framework called the peptidoglycan, consisting of polysaccharide chains cross linked by peptide units.
